Call barring
Select Menu > Ctrl. panel > Settings and Phone >
Call barring.
You can bar the calls that can be made or received with
the device (network service). To change the settings,
you need the barring password from your service
provider. Call barring affects all call types.
To bar calls, select Voice call barring and from the
following:
Outgoing calls — Prevent making voice calls with
your device.
Incoming calls — Prevent incoming calls.
International calls — Prevent calling to foreign
countries or regions.
Incoming calls when roaming — Prevent
incoming calls when outside your home country.
International calls except to home country
— Prevent calls to foreign countries or regions, but
allow calls to your home country.
To check the status of voice call barrings, select the
barring option and Options > Check status.
To deactivate all voice call barrings, select a barring
option and Options > Deactivate all barrings.
To change the password used for barring voice and fax
calls, select Voice call barring > Options > Edit
barring password. Enter the current code, then the
new code twice. The barring password must be four
digits long. For details, contact your service provider.
Bar net calls
Select Menu > Ctrl. panel > Settings and Phone >
Call barring > Internet call barring.
To reject net calls from anonymous callers, select
Anonymous call barring > On.
